Abstract

Aspects of the invention can provide a display device, a display method, and a projection type display device that allow a characteristic of a display image such as brightness to be continuously changed. The display device can include a light source capable of emitting a plurality of different color lights and a white light, and an optical modulation device for modulating light corresponding to the lights emitted from the light source. The ratio of the period of emitting the white light relative to the total of the periods of emitting the lights from the light source can be variable.

Claims

exact text as granted — not AI-modified
1 . A display device, comprising: 
 a light source capable of time-sequentially emitting a plurality of different color lights and a white light;    an optical modulation device that modulates light corresponding to the lights emitted from the light source; and    a ratio of a period of emitting the white light relative to a total of the periods of emitting the lights from the light source being variable.    
   
   
       2 . The display device according to  claim 1 , 
 the ratio of the periods of emitting the plurality of different color lights and the white light being capable of being adjusted to a prescribed value.    
   
   
       3 . The display device according to  claim 2 , 
 the ratio of the period of emitting the white light being adjusted based on a video signal input to the display device.    
   
   
       4 . The display device according to  claim 2 , further comprising: 
 brightness detection device that detects an ambient brightness; and    the ratio of the period of emitting the white light being adjusted based on the output of the brightness detection device.    
   
   
       5 . The display device according to  claim 2 , further comprising: 
 an input portion that inputs the ratio of the period of emitting said white light; and    the ratio of the period of emitting the white light being adjusted based on information input to the input portion.    
   
   
       6 . The display device according to  claim 1 , 
 the light source having light emitting portions that emit the plurality of different color lights respectively.    
   
   
       7 . The display device according to  claim 6 , 
 the light emitting portion being a solid light source.    
   
   
       8 . The display device according to  claim 6 , 
 during the period of emitting said white light, the white light being emitted by simultaneously emitting different color lights from the light emitting portions that emit the different color lights.    
   
   
       9 . The display device according to  claim 6 , 
 the light source having a white light emitting portion that can emit the white light; and    during the period of emitting the white light, a white light being emitted from the white light emitting portion.    
   
   
       10 . The display device according to  claim 1 , 
 the different color lights being sequentially emitted on a basis of a sub unit period produced by dividing one unit period for producing an image; and    the white light being emitted in a part of the sub unit period.    
   
   
       11 . The display device according to  claim 1 , 
 the different color lights being sequentially emitted on a basis of a sub unit period produced by dividing one unit period for producing an image; and    when the white light is emitted, a sub unit period for emitting the white light is added to the unit period.    
   
   
       12 . The display device according to  claim 11 , 
 the duration of the unit period being the same as the duration without the additional sub unit period for emitting said white light.    
   
   
       13 . The display device according to  claim 11 , 
 the duration of the sub unit periods being the same regardless of the presence/absence of the sub unit period for emitting the white light.    
   
   
       14 . The display device according to  claim 1 , 
 the optical modulation device being a liquid crystal panel.    
   
   
       15 . A displaying method using a display device, the display device comprising: 
 a light source capable of time-sequentially emitting a plurality of different color lights and a white light;    an optical modulation device that modulates light corresponding to the lights emitted from the light source; and    a ratio of a period of emitting the white light relative to a total of the periods of emitting the lights from the light source being variable.    
   
   
       16 . A projection type display device, comprising: 
 a display device according to  claim 1.
